Poor Digestion: Top 4 Ways To Improve Your Gut Health

Digestion problem is a common health issue, and more than 40% of adults worldwide suffer from a functional gastrointestinal disorder. It is something that you should not overlook.

Your digestive system plays a crucial role in your body. It breaks down the food you eat into essential nutrients that your body needs. If you overlook this health issue, you could run into problems absorbing the essential nutrients.

But what causes digestive problems? Here are some of the factors that affect your digestive system:

  • Stress
  • Eat a diet low in fiber
  • Lack of exercise
  • Consuming dairy products
  • Sudden changes in routine, etc.

The food you eat and the lifestyle you live can have a major impact on your digestive health. Taking steps to improve your digestive health can help your digestive function work efficiently and improve your overall health.

Eat More Fiber

As said earlier, eating a diet low in fiber is a major factor that affects your gut health. However, experts exclaim that eating more fiber can improve your digestive health. Apart from improving digestion, eating fiber has several health benefits. For example, eating fiber can lower cholesterol levels, reduce the risk of heart diseases, control blood sugar levels, maintain bowel health, etc.

Some good sources of fiber include:

  • Chia seeds
  • Almonds
  • Beans
  • Strawberries
  • Oranges
  • Broccoli
  • Oatmeal, etc.

You should also consider drinking plenty of liquids so that the fiber absorbs enough water to pass through your digestive system.

Exercise Regularly To Beat Bloating

Exercising regularly can help you get rid of gut problems like bloating and constipation. Moreover, regular exercising helps you reduce stress, which can trigger several digestion problems.
